    I have had a Logic Combi 30 fitted with radiators. 3 radiators down stairs, 3 1st floor where boiler is.

    My question is that I would like to fit a radiator with in the loft and bathroom I know that the BTU for the loft is about 5500 and bathroom is 1350.

    Firstly would I be able to do this and where do I cut in the loop?
     
  2. tom.plum

    tom.plum Screwfix Select

    yes, cut in where the pipes are 22mm if possible, if not the second best option is cut into 15mm pipes, don't try teeing into 10mm pipes that won't work,
